Abstract

MACHINE ÉLECTRIQUE TOURNANTE À AIMANTS SURFACIQUES La machine électrique tournante comprenant un stator (1c) et un rotor (2c), le rotor comprenant des pôles magnétiques formés d’aimants permanents surfaciques (21c) qui sont fixés sur un arbre (20c) du rotor. Conformément à l’invention, la machine comprend une couche de jonction frittée entre chacun des aimants permanents surfaciques et l’arbre, chaque couche de jonction frittée assurant une liaison mécanique permanente entre un aimant permanent surfacique et l’arbre et étant obtenue par une technique de frittage.
